- Tangaroa gets a new turquoise paint job, inspired by the turquoise waters we will be sailing through as well as two tribal orca's painted on the bows (Tangaroa is a polynesian Catamaran). Orcas are known to some tribes as guardians of the sea, protecting the sea people. Plus fresh anti fowl and new trampolines that we hand weave ourselves Tanga is looking fresh and sexy!
